Time Travel: Is Interstellar Exploration the Solution?
The pursuit of time travel has long captivated thinkers, often appearing as pure imagination. However, some groundbreaking theories suggest a surprising link – could overcoming the vastness of the cosmos actually hold the clue to traversing history? Einstein’s theory of relativity demonstrates that motion significantly impacts the experience of time; the faster one proceeds, the slower time passes compared to a immobile observer. Therefore, achieving substantial space flight speeds, perhaps nearing the pace of light, could, in theory, create some kind of temporal displacement, potentially opening ways to understanding, and perhaps even altering, the fourth aspect of existence.

Wormhole Physics: A Future regarding Galactic Travel?
Despite currently firmly relegated to the realm for theoretical physics, wormholes – predicted tunnels through spacetime – offer a potential connection for intergalactic travel. Current understanding, founded on Einstein’s theory of general relativity, allows for their mathematical existence, but forming a stable and navigable wormhole poses significant challenges. These require negative matter – such substance with opposing mass-energy density – for keep the entrance from the wormhole open , as well as overcoming subatomic instabilities. Considering current research exploring dark matter and advanced drive technologies, realistic wormhole travel persists a remote prospect, however inspires scientific exploration into the fundamental properties reality.
Temporal Travel Paradoxes and Starship Routing
The theoretical intersection of chronological displacement and vessel routing presents a fascinating, and frequently problematic, issue. If a explorer were to embark on a passage allowing for prior movement in temporal flow , the potential for paradoxes becomes exceedingly high . Consider the classic "grandfather paradox ": preventing one's own existence through altering the earlier period . Such a scenario immediately raises problems about the fabric of existence and the feasibility of reliable cosmic plotting. Further complicating matters is the potential for closed chronological sequences, where actions endlessly cycle, potentially causing predictability utterly impossible .
